JavaScript
var camera;
var controls;
var scene;
var torus;
var light;
var renderer;
var w = window.innerWidth;
var h = window.innerHeight;
init();
animate();
function init() {
//camera
camera = new THREE.PerspectiveCamera(45, w / h, 1, 5000);
camera.position.set(0, 200, -500);
//Scene
scene = new THREE.Scene();
// Helpers
axes = new THREE.AxisHelper(50);
helper = new THREE.GridHelper(1000, 10, 0x0000ff, 0x808080);
scene.add(axes);
scene.add(helper);
// Torus Geometry
torus = new THREE.Mesh(new THREE.TorusGeometry(120, 60, 40, 40),
new THREE.MeshNormalMaterial());
torus.position.set(0, 0, 0);
scene.add(torus);
//Hemisphere Light
light = new THREE.HemisphereLight(0xffbf67, 0x15c6ff);
scene.add(light);
//WebGL Renderer
renderer = new THREE.WebGLRenderer({
antialias: true
});
//controls
controls = new THREE.OrbitControls(camera, renderer.domElement);
controls.rotateSpeed = 1.0;
controls.zoomSpeed = 1.2;
controls.panSpeed = 0.8;
//renderer.setClearColor(0xffffff, 1)
renderer.setSize(w, h);
$('.webgl').append(renderer.domElement);
$('.clicks').click(function () {
var from = camera.position.clone();
var to = camera.position.clone().subScalar(100);
// initially, camera looks at the center of the scene
// next line makes it to look at the top of the torus
controls.target = new THREE.Vector3(0, 120, 0); // set target once, not in .onUpdate
var tween = new TWEEN.Tween(from)
.to(to, 600)
.easing(TWEEN.Easing.Linear.None)
.onUpdate( function(){
camera.position.copy(this);
controls.update();
})
.start();
});
}// init end
function animate() {
requestAnimationFrame(animate);
TWEEN.update();
renderer.render(scene, camera);
}
